The Core Foundations of Fabric and Texture

The tactile experience of a garment, often referred to as its "hand-feel," is determined by the raw materials and weaving techniques used in its creation. Fabric is the fundamental building block of clothing, and its properties dictate how a garment moves, breathes, and ages.

Natural Fibers and Their Performance Metrics

Natural fibers remain the benchmark for luxury and comfort due to their breathability and unique textures.

  • Cotton Varieties: Not all cotton is created equal. Long-staple cotton, such as Egyptian or Pima cotton, features longer fibers that result in a smoother, stronger yarn. In our testing of high-count cotton poplin (around 100/2 ply), we observed a distinctive "crispness" that holds its shape throughout a workday, making it the ideal choice for formal shirting.
  • Wool and Thermal Regulation: Wool is a protein fiber with natural crimp, providing insulation and moisture-wicking properties. Merino wool, known for its fine micron count (often below 18.5 microns), is soft enough to be worn against the skin without irritation. For heavier outerwear, Harris Tweed offers a coarse, wind-resistant texture that has protected wearers in harsh climates for centuries.
  • Silk’s Luminescence: Silk is a continuous protein filament. Its triangular structure allows it to refract light like a prism, giving it a natural shimmer. When evaluating heavy silk charmeuse, the weight (measured in momme) is the primary indicator of quality; a 19-22 momme silk provides a substantial drape that resists the "flimsiness" of cheaper alternatives.

Synthetic Innovations and Functional Blends

While natural fibers are prized, modern synthetic materials provide technical advantages that nature cannot replicate. Polyester offers exceptional durability and wrinkle resistance, while Elastane (Spandex) introduced the concept of "stretch" to modern clothing.

In high-performance environments, moisture-wicking synthetics utilize capillary action to pull sweat away from the body. However, the most effective modern clothing often utilizes a blend. A 98% cotton and 2% elastane blend, for instance, retains the aesthetic of traditional denim while allowing for the mobility required in contemporary urban life.

Understanding Fit and Silhouette: The Architecture of the Body

If fabric is the material, fit is the architecture. The silhouette of a garment—the overall shape it creates—can alter the perceived proportions of the human body, communicating power, ease, or avant-garde sensibility.

Structured vs. Unstructured Tailoring

The difference between a "power suit" and a casual blazer lies in the internal construction. Structured clothing utilizes canvassing (layers of horsehair or synthetic material) and shoulder padding to create a specific shape regardless of the wearer's anatomy. This is common in traditional British tailoring, where the goal is a sharp, authoritative silhouette.

Conversely, unstructured or "soft" tailoring, popularized by Italian designers, removes the internal padding. The garment relies entirely on the drape of the fabric and the precision of the cut to follow the natural lines of the body. This creates a more relaxed, approachable aesthetic that has become the standard for "smart-casual" dress codes.

Decoding Modern Silhouettes

Modern clothing generally falls into four primary silhouette categories:

  1. Fitted/Slim: Contours closely to the body's natural shape.
  2. A-Line: Narrow at the top and widening toward the hem, often used in skirts and coats to create a sense of movement.
  3. Oversized/Boxy: Disregards the body's natural lines to create a voluminous, often architectural look. This is a hallmark of contemporary streetwear and minimalist design.
  4. Draped: Utilizes the weight of the fabric to create fluid, organic shapes that move with the wearer.

The Subtle Language of Details and Trims

A garment’s quality is often revealed in the details that are invisible from a distance. These "trims" are the final ingredients that provide character and functionality.

Buttons and Fasteners

Plastic buttons are the industry standard, but high-quality clothing often utilizes natural materials. Mother-of-pearl (MOP) buttons, derived from mollusk shells, offer a depth of color and heat resistance that plastic cannot match. Horn buttons, typically sourced from water buffalo, provide a unique, organic grain pattern essential for traditional trench coats and blazers.

Seams and Stitching

The density of stitches (measured in Stitches Per Inch, or SPI) is a reliable proxy for durability. Standard garments may have 8-10 SPI, whereas high-end luxury pieces often feature 18-22 SPI. Fine stitching prevents the seams from puckering and ensures the garment can withstand the tension of repeated movement.

Furthermore, specialized seams like the "flat-felled seam" found in heavy-duty denim or the "French seam" used in delicate silk lingerie provide a clean finish on the interior, preventing fraying and increasing the lifespan of the item.

The Social Psychology of Clothing

Clothing is a non-verbal communication system. Every choice of color, pattern, and style sends a signal to the observer about the wearer's identity, profession, and social status.

Color and Perception

Color psychology plays a significant role in how clothes are perceived. Navy blue is universally associated with trust and stability, which is why it remains the dominant color for professional uniforms and corporate attire. Red, conversely, suggests energy and dominance. In our observation of public speaking environments, individuals wearing "power colors" like deep red or charcoal grey often command more immediate attention than those in muted tones or pastels.

Patterns and Cultural Signaling

Patterns carry historical and cultural weight. Pinstripes are historically linked to the banking and financial sectors of London. Tartans and plaids often signal heritage or, in the case of the 1970s punk movement, a subversion of traditional values. Floral prints can evoke themes of romanticism or seasonality, depending on the scale and color palette of the design.

The Historical Evolution of Dress

The history of clothing is a history of human adaptation. While early humans likely used animal skins for basic thermal protection, the evolution of clothing became a tool for social differentiation.

Archaeological Foundations

Recent anthropological studies, including genetic analysis of the body louse (which evolved to live in clothing), suggest that humans began wearing garments approximately 107,000 years ago. This timing coincides with the migration of Homo sapiens out of the warm African climate into colder northern regions.

Evidence from Morocco points to specialized bone tools used for skinning animals as far back as 120,000 years ago, indicating that the processing of materials for "clothing" predates the complex weaving of textiles. By 30,000 BC, the invention of the bone needle allowed for the creation of form-fitting garments, moving away from simple drapes to tailored skins.

The Transition to Industrial Production

The Industrial Revolution in the 18th and 19th centuries fundamentally changed our relationship with clothes. The transition from bespoke, hand-sewn garments to mass-produced "ready-to-wear" (RTW) clothing democratized fashion but also led to the standardization of sizes. This era birthed the modern fashion industry, moving the focus from durability and repair to trend-cycling and seasonal consumption.

Sustainable Stewardship: Maintaining the Life of Clothing

In an era of fast fashion, the ability to maintain and repair clothing has become a vital skill for the conscious consumer. The longevity of a garment is 50% construction and 50% maintenance.

The Importance of Proper Laundry

Frequent washing is one of the primary causes of clothing degradation. Heat and mechanical agitation break down fibers, especially in natural materials like wool and silk.

  • Dry Cleaning: Should be used sparingly, as the harsh chemicals (such as perchloroethylene) can strip natural oils from wool.
  • Air Drying: Whenever possible, air drying is preferable to machine drying. High heat causes "fiber stress," leading to shrinkage and loss of elasticity.

Repair Culture: Darning and Mending

The art of mending is seeing a resurgence. "Visible mending," where repairs are made using contrasting colors, celebrates the history of a garment rather than hiding its age. Darning—a technique for repairing holes in knitwear by weaving new yarn into the structure—can extend the life of a cashmere sweater by decades.

What is the difference between clothing, apparel, and attire?

While often used interchangeably, these terms have subtle distinctions in a professional context:

  • Clothing: The most general term, referring to any garments worn on the body.
  • Apparel: Often used in a commercial or industrial sense (e.g., "the apparel industry") to describe mass-produced garments.
  • Attire: A more formal term, usually referring to clothing worn for a specific occasion (e.g., "business attire" or "formal attire").

How to accurately describe the condition of vintage clothing?

When evaluating or describing older garments, specific terminology ensures clarity:

  • Deadstock/Pristine: Never worn, often with original tags.
  • Excellent: Shows minimal signs of wear with no structural flaws.
  • Very Good: May have minor fading or "pilling" but remains structurally sound.
  • Distressed: Intentionally worn or aged, often a stylistic choice in denim and streetwear.

FAQ

What are the most durable fabrics for everyday wear? For durability, look for high-density weaves like cotton twill (denim and chino) or heavy-weight wool. Synthetic blends that include nylon or polyester also significantly increase abrasion resistance.

Why is fit considered more important than the brand? A poorly fitting garment, regardless of its price or brand name, disrupts the visual proportions of the body and can appear "cheap." A well-fitted, lower-cost garment will always look more professional and intentional because it respects the wearer's anatomy.

How does clothing impact psychological performance? Commonly known as "enclothed cognition," studies suggest that the clothes we wear can influence our psychological processes. For example, wearing a lab coat or a structured suit can increase focus and confidence in tasks associated with those roles.

How can I tell if a garment is high quality in a store? Check the seams for high stitch density, ensure patterns (like stripes or checks) match at the seams, and feel the weight of the fabric. Natural buttons and reinforced buttonholes are also strong indicators of quality construction.
